Oh, neat!  I’m quoted in Julia’s Wired cover story:

“People have been so paranoid about having any presence online for such a long time,” says David Karp, founder of the Tumblr blogging service and a friend of Allison’s. “A lot of them have gone through that transition of ‘Well, shit, it’s out there. I’m searchable on Flickr or Google.’ The cat is out of the bag, and the only way to take back that control is to get out there and have a presence, have an identity that you feel represents you.”

I like this quote a lot. That’s why my tumblelog says a lot more about me than any bio, resume or profile someone else’s site.
